Deploy a specific hyperkube imageΒΆ

By default fuel-ccp-installer uses an hyperkube image downloaded from the quay.io images repository. See the variables hyperkube_image_repo and hyperkube_image_tag variables in the kargo_default_common.yaml file.

To use a specific version of hyperkube the hyperkube_image_repo and hyperkube_image_tag variables can be set in the deploy-k8s.sh script. This is done through the CUSTOM_YAML environment variable. Here is an example:

#!/bin/bash
set -ex

# CHANGE ADMIN_IP AND SLAVE_IPS TO MATCH YOUR ENVIRONMENT
export ADMIN_IP="10.90.0.2"
export SLAVE_IPS="10.90.0.2 10.90.0.3 10.90.0.4"
export DEPLOY_METHOD="kargo"
export WORKSPACE="${HOME}/workspace"
export CUSTOM_YAML='hyperkube_image_repo: "gcr.io/google_containers/hyperkube-amd64"
hyperkube_image_tag: "v1.3.7"
'

mkdir -p $WORKSPACE
cd ./fuel-ccp-installer
bash -x "./utils/jenkins/run_k8s_deploy_test.sh"

In this example the CUSTOM_YAML variable includes the definitions of the hyperkube_image_repo and hyperkube_image_tag variables, defining what hyperkube image to use and what repository to get the image from.
